Alex Guerrero 198 lbs lost to Brian Howard 196 lbs by TKO at 1:53 in round 1 of 8

Referee: Harvey Dock

TIme: 1:53 of the first round

In the main event of a nine bout card at Resorts New World Casino, promoted by DiBella Entertainment and New Legend, former cruiserweight contender Brian Howard returned to the ring with a first round knockout over undefeated Alex Guerrero. Howard, in the gym for a year working with the new team of Elvin Thompson, Harold Neal and Ofa Donaldson, came forward right away and engaged Guerrero in technical jab exchanges. At some point, Guerrero stood in front of Howard and tried to crowd him from throwing jabs, looking to counter anything Howard might throw, lacking defense. Howard landed a straight right with power to the head of Guerrero, sending him to the canvas. Guerrero beat the count and got another chance, but still appeared badly hurt and his legs were gone. Howard immediately came forward when the bout continued and landed a flurry of power shots on Guerrero, who pitched backwards off the ropes to the canvas down and out. The outcome did not appear to be an upset. In the post fight interview, Howard stated he was interested in a rematch with Harvey Jolly, a bout he took on short notice unprepared several years ago. Howard also expressed an interest in fighting former USBA cruiserweight champion Garrett Wilson.
